YouTube: The Power of Consistency

YouTube is not just for long-form content anymore. With the introduction of YouTube Shorts, creators have another avenue to reach a broader audience.

  • Create Playlists: Organize your videos into playlists to encourage binge-watching. Longer watch times can boost your video in YouTube's algorithm.
  • Engage with Comments: Responding to viewer comments can build a community and encourage more interaction.

Telegram: A Hub for Direct Engagement

While Telegram might not be the first platform you think of for social growth, it offers unique opportunities for direct engagement.

  • Create Exclusive Channels: Reward your most loyal followers with exclusive content or early access to products.
  • Use Bots for Engagement: Automate welcome messages or FAQs to keep your community active and informed.
